Description

This attractive two double-bedroom link-detached bungalow is ideally positioned in the sought-after market town of Bakewell, enjoying superb views towards Manners Woods and the surrounding countryside. The property occupies a lovely position on a quiet residential drive with a single garage and driveway parking for two cars. Offered to the market with no onward chain, an internal viewing is essential.

The front door opens into an entrance hall giving access to all rooms. The spacious sitting room benefits from a front-facing aspect with far-reaching views, and the focal point of the room is a fireplace with electric fire. An opening leads through to the extended dining kitchen, situated at the heart of the home. The well-appointed kitchen features a range of units with worktops, sink and drainer, double oven, four-burner hob with extractor, and under-counter fridge. The adjoining triple-aspect dining area enjoys pleasant views up the garden and opens onto a level patio, making it an ideal space for entertaining.

A door from the kitchen leads into the single garage, currently used as a practical utility area with sink, freezer and washing machine. The garage would benefit from updating but provides excellent storage and direct access to the rear garden.

The property has two generous double bedrooms, one overlooking the rear garden and the other enjoying views towards Manners Woods. The family bathroom includes a bath with shower over, low-flush WC, bidet and pedestal wash basin.

Outside, the front of the property features driveway parking for two vehicles, a low-maintenance gravel garden and a selection of shrubs. To the rear, a delightful garden is laid mainly to lawn with deep floral borders, two patio seating areas and stunning views.
